Hainan's Innovative Approach: Advancing Global Healthcare Through Policy Openness
In February 2025, Hainan's Boao Lecheng International Medical Tourism Pilot Zone reached a notable achievement by executing China's first temporary importation and application of special medical formula food. This milestone underscores Hainan's emerging role in medical innovation and collaboration in international healthcare.

The advancement came after the approval of provisional regulations on December 30, 2024, which permit designated medical institutions within the pilot zone to legally import specific quantities of specialized medical food, full-nutrition medical products for rare diseases, and relevant dietary supplements that are marketed overseas.

Since its establishment in 2013, the pilot zone in Boao has played a crucial role in transforming China's healthcare sector. It utilizes special policies to expedite the adoption of internationally licensed pharmaceuticals and medical devices that are not yet available in the domestic market, thereby providing patients with access to advanced treatments.

China has implemented various policies in Hainan to attract global medical enterprises and enhance healthcare accessibility. On November 29, 2024, the country announced its intention to allow the establishment of wholly foreign-owned hospitals in major cities such as Beijing, Shanghai, and Shenzhen, in addition to Hainan Province. This initiative aims to bolster international medical cooperation and broaden healthcare services in the region.

The province's adaptable Free Trade Port policies have further stimulated innovation by drawing in global healthcare enterprises, fostering advancements, and improving access to state-of-the-art treatments.

Hainan's development closely aligns with China's "Healthy China 2030" initiative, which prioritizes healthcare innovation, technological advancement, and international collaboration. By streamlining approval processes, diversifying medical offerings, and enhancing patient care, Hainan is solidifying its status as a significant player in global healthcare evolution.

In line with the 2025 Boao Forum for Asia's central theme, "Building Trust and Promoting Cooperation in a Fast-Changing World," Hainan's initiatives have reinforced its position as a hub for international medical collaboration. The upcoming Boao Forum for Asia Annual Conference, set to take place from March 25 to 28 in Boao, will further showcase the region's impact on driving healthcare innovation and cultivating international partnerships.
